Robert Breault Obituary

Robert Joseph (Bob) Breault, Jr., 67

Portland, Oregon - Bob Breault died in the home he shared with his son on Tuesday, February 11, 2014 after a long illness. Bob was born in Worcester on January 24, 1947, son of the late Robert and Mary (Ceronne) Breault. He was a graduate of Classical High School and The College of Engineering at UMass Lowell. Bob worked for the U.S. Postal Service for 17 years prior to retiring in 2007. He loved following the Patriots & Red Sox, visiting Disneyworld, going for long walks with his dog, and spending time with his grandchildren. He is survived by son and daughter, Matthew Breault and Melissa Pace; daughter, Meghan Breault; two sisters, Patricia Breault and Debora Honan; two grandchildren, Henry and Clarice Pace; and one nephew, Tyler Dell'Aquila. A burial service will be held in Worcester sometime in the spring.
